I am looking into a problem another SA is having at our site with Fortran
for AIX. I thought I would ask this question as I look into the problem.
He is trying to load IBM XL Fortran V6 R1 on a H50 and p170 both running
AIX 5.1... He is getting the following:

 MISSING REQUISITES: The following file sets are required by one or more
  of the selected file sets listed above. They are not currently installed
  and could not be found on the installation media.

    bos.loc.iso.ja_JP 4.1.0.0 # Base Level Fileset
    bos.rte v=4, r<3 # Base Level Fileset
    cobol.cmp 1.1.0.0 # Base Level Fileset
     pli.base 1.1.0.0 # Base Level Fileset
    xlC.C 3.1.1.0 # Base Level Fileset
    xlhpf.cmp 1.1.0.0 # Base Level Fileset

I am going to load the 5.1 CD's and look to see if these are even there.
As I look at the Fortran CD's it does say for AIX Version 4.

Does anyone know if this version of fortran even supposed to work on AIX
5L.
